1918/00/00 Huey Long and family settle in at a modest, Colonial Revival style residence at 2403 Laurel Street in Shreveport, Louisiana. The Long family will live here until 1926. The house, built c 1905, burned down in September 1992. Home
1932/00/00 During the 1930s, US Senator Huey P Long uses a 12th-floor suite at The Roosevelt as his Louisiana headquarters and New Orleans residence. He is known to enjoy a Ramos Gin Fizz in the Main Bar as he speaks to his constituents. Guest The Roosevelt New Orleans New Orleans Ramos Gin Fizz
